This Pregnant News Anchor's Reaction to Being Called "Disgusting" Is Priceless

If you have a job in the public eye, it's no secret that the spotlight can be a particularly brutal place. And apparently now pregnant women are no exception.

Laura Warren, a TV anchor in Augusta, GA, took to her blog Bump, Baby, and Breaking News to share her feelings after getting an anonymous phone call on July 3 from a viewer calling her pregnant body "disgusting."

The caller left a voicemail on Warren's phone telling her to "please go to Target and buy some decent maternity clothes so you don't walk around looking like you got a watermelon strapped under your too tight outfits. Target's got a great line of maternity clothes in case you've never heard of such a thing. You're getting to where you're being disgusting on the TV."

And while Warren knows the perils of living life in the limelight and has developed a thick skin over the years, she took this jab at her pregnancy to heart.

The news anchor - who's only 20 weeks along - deleted the voicemail and addressed her initial feelings in her blog, writing: "Did she just call a pregnant person disgusting? What kind of... I am only at week 20 of this? Am I going to have to deal with this crap another 20 weeks? Should I have my consultant or my boss call her and tell her tailored, form fitting clothes look way better on air than baggy ones, especially when pregnant? Is that a WOMAN who called me?!? Is she a MOTHER?!?!? The freaking nerve..."

She also got into how hard it is to be pregnant to begin with, especially when you're going on camera in front of thousands of people each day. "Now, throw yourself in front of a camera that adds 20 pounds every night, find clothes that not only fit, but also don't make you look like a whale, and cake on enough hair and makeup products twice a day to moonlight as a Las Vegas showgirl, and you'll understand where I'm coming from," she said.

After weighing her options, the expectant mom decided to take the high road.

"So, I think instead of letting this lady get me down, I'm just going to turn her negative energy into positive energy," Warren reasoned. "I'm going to say as many nice things as I can to as many people as I can, and I'm going to do it in a dress that fits these beautiful new curves with my 'watermelon' stomach showing."
